Description
This is a chest tomb located about 28 meters north of the tower of the Church of St Peter, dating from the early 19th century. It is made of stone and features trapezoidal side panels that create outward sloping sides. The top of the tomb is concave with a hipped ridged shape. The side panels are also trapezoidal and include a dagger design between them, decorated with a stylized leaf. The inscriptions on the tomb are now illegible.
